Buying Guide: Key Purchases For 6.7 Cummins Tuning And Upgrades
When selecting parts to support a diesel tuner for the 6.7 Cummins, consider the following perspectives and criteria:
- Compatibility and coverage: Verify model year, engine code, and emissions requirements (CARB status matters for state compliance). A tuner should explicitly support your truck’s year range and engine configuration.
- Power and drivability: Look for tuners that offer multiple driving profiles (daily, tow, performance) with clear, measurable gain ranges. Real-world testing and user reviews help judge whether power gains translate into improved throttle response and towing performance.
- Reliability and safety: A trusted tuner follows safe tune limits to avoid excessive EGT or trans wear. Pair tuners with cooling upgrades, thermostat or bypass solutions, and high-quality filters to sustain engine health under higher load.
- OBDII integration and updates: A modern tuner should support WiFi or mobile updates, on-device data logging, and straightforward installation with minimal wiring.
- Fuel and filtration: Upgrades such as OEM-style filters and additive CCV components help maintain fuel purity and oil cleanliness, which contribute to sustained performance and reduced maintenance costs.
- Maintenance-friendly approach: Consider components that fit standard OEM locations and have readily available replacements to limit downtime and ensure long-term serviceability.
- Resale value and warranty implications: Check whether the tuner or upgrade affects warranty terms or dealer service options. Some modifications may affect coverage under certain warranties.
